CPI(M) slams White Paper, calls it a roadmap for disinvestment, privatisation

Communist Party of India (Marxist) [CPI(M)] He criticized the United Democratic Front (UDF) government’s White Paper on Kerala’s financial situation, arguing that the document strengthens the privatization policy followed by the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P)-led Union government.

The CPI(M) State secretariat said the White Paper hints that the State government is retreating from welfare programs and people-oriented development that were hitherto enjoyed by the people. He warned of serious public backlash against the government.

The CPI(M) said the stated purpose of the White Paper was to disclose the State’s financial position, but the document announced disinvestment or privatization of ministries providing public services.

No democratic government would consider profit-oriented industries in health, education, public distribution, electricity, drinking water supply and transportation as services to the public. Approaching them through their ability to make profits is tantamount to viewing them through the prism of neo-liberal privatization policies. CPI(M) said the White Paper shows that Chief Minister VD Satheesan is walking on the same path as Prime Minister Narendra Modi.

The announcement that the retirement age will be raised to the same level as the central services is tantamount to saying that new appointments will be banned for the next five years. CPI(M) said this was a challenge to the youth of the state.
